16-16-17.5. Review of conditional admission.

The Board of Bar Examiners shall review each conditional admission no later than the date specified in the Supreme Court's order granting conditional admission. The board shall recommend to the Supreme Court that:
(1)The conditional admission be terminated, resulting in loss of license; or
(2)That the conditional admission be modified and/or extended; or
(3)That full admission be granted.
The Supreme Court may accept or reject the recommendation.
